Myth 1: A Little Chip Doesn't Need Immediate Attention

One of the most common beliefs is that a little chip or crack in the windshield is nothing to worry about. After all, it's simply a minor blemish, right? Incorrect. A small chip can rapidly become a larger concern if left ignored. Temperature changes, vibrations from driving, and even the passage of time can trigger these little imperfections to expand into considerable cracks. Neglecting this seemingly harmless chip could cause needing a full windshield replacement rather than just a basic repair.

In my career, I've come across lots of clients who postponed repairs just to discover themselves dealing with much greater expenses later on. It's always best to attend to any damage as soon as you see it.

Myth 3: Insurance Always Covers Windshield Repairs

Many drivers believe their insurance will cover any windshield-related problems without considering their policy details. While detailed insurance coverage frequently covers repair work or replacements, not all policies are created equivalent. Some may require you to pay a deductible before coverage begins, while others might cover repair work fully but not replacements.

Always check your insurance policy's specifics concerning glass coverage before assuming you're totally protected. This knowledge can save you from unexpected out-of-pocket costs during what must be an uncomplicated process.

Myth 5: Windshield Replacement Is Constantly Required For Significant Damage

Some individuals assume that any visible crack means they should change their whole windshield. However, not all damage needs such drastic steps. Depending on aspects like size, type, and area of the crack or chip, experienced service technicians can typically perform effective repairs without needing a completely new windshield.

For example, cracks shorter than 3 inches are generally repairable if they lie outside of the motorist's direct line of vision. A comprehensive assessment by a specialist will offer clearness on whether repair work or replacement is genuinely necessary.

Myth 6: All Windshields Are Made From The Exact Same Material

Another widespread mistaken belief is that all windshields are made from similar materials. In reality, there are various kinds of glass utilized for various vehicles-- most typically laminated safety glass for windshields and tempered glass for side windows.

Laminated glass consists of two layers with a plastic interlayer sandwiched in between them; this design assists keep shattered pieces intact throughout mishaps and improves total safety. Understanding these distinctions is necessary when going over repairs or replacements with specialists who require specific information about your automobile's make and model.

Myth 7: You Can Drive Right After Getting Your Windscreen Repaired

After having your windscreen repaired or replaced, some believe they can immediately strike the road without issue; however, this isn't always true. While numerous contemporary adhesives enable quicker curing times than older approaches did-- in some cases as short as one hour-- it's still recommended to follow your technician's recommendations closely regarding wait times before driving again.

Driving too soon may interfere with the recently applied adhesive's treating procedure and might weaken its efficiency over time.
